Amid the unprecedented challenges presented by COVID-19, questions around the use of second medical use (SMU) patents have become increasingly pertinent. On Tuesday December 1, LSPN Connect’s session: Addressing Second Medical Use Infringement: An Evaluation of Recent SMU Cases will examine a number of key issues relating to this pivotal area of life sciences IP.
